Transaction 6a70fd3d72f92b6575049cd9488514e66c9e39a10bd2ca2539483addc405df59

2 Input
2 Outputs
  • 6a70fd3d72f92b6575049cd9488514e66c9e39a10bd2ca2539483addc405df59:0
  • value  2808247
    address  33o4KHDWrsDPHDQsFJF3R2KhU4zP6hS9EX
  • 6a70fd3d72f92b6575049cd9488514e66c9e39a10bd2ca2539483addc405df59:1
  • value  1640707
    address  3QVgJJG8YK7fEHNKYm4QExQqMRg2Jwy5mL